Agenda for Calendar and Todo for tasks, both are dead simple but allow some tweeks such as repeating appointments on like the 3rd Thursday of the Month. Fantastical is pretty and has some nice features but the repeating appointments killed it for me. Clear is also pretty slick, if you don't have recurring tasks.
